Information:
-
a nucleotide consists of three components
-
phosphate [purple]
-
sugar [white]
-
one of four nitrogen bases
-
thymine [yellow]
-
cytosine [blue]
-
Guanine [green]
-
Adenine [red]
-
therefore, there are four nucleotides
100 000's of these nuclotide units
are found in an area called the nuclotide pool (located in a cells' nucleus
